DF11-8DP-2DSA(20) Equivalent & Substitute Parts

Part Overview

The DF11-8DP-2DSA(20) is a rectangular connector header manufactured by Hirose Electric Co Ltd, designed for through-hole mounting in board-to-board or cable applications. This 8-position, 2-row connector operates at 2A current rating and 250V voltage rating with a 0.079" (2.00mm) pitch configuration. The part is classified as obsolete, necessitating identification of equivalent alternatives that maintain electrical and mechanical compatibility for ongoing production and repair applications.

Engineering Selection Recommendations

DF11-8DP-2DSA(24) is the primary substitute, offering identical electrical and mechanical specifications with active product status and ROHS3 compliance. This part maintains the same manufacturer lineage and series designation, ensuring design compatibility.

1470109-8 (TE Connectivity AMPMODU series) provides an alternative with higher current rating (3A) and equivalent voltage performance. The lower voltage rating (100VDC) requires application verification where 250V operation is specified.

B8B-PHDSS(LF)(SN) (JST PHD series) offers equivalent electrical performance with higher current capacity (3A) and maintains 250V voltage rating. The glass-filled nylon insulation provides enhanced mechanical properties.

SWR204-NRTN-D04-ST-GA (Sullins SWR204 series) is suitable for applications where the 50V voltage rating is sufficient. This part provides the highest current rating (3A per contact) and active product status with ROHS3 compliance.

All substitute parts maintain UL94 V-0 flammability rating and MSL 1 moisture sensitivity classification. Selection should be based on application voltage and current requirements, with preference for active product status and ROHS3 compliance for new designs.

Frequently Asked Questions (FAQ)

Q: Can DF11-8DP-2DSA(24) be used as a direct replacement for DF11-8DP-2DSA(20)?

A: Yes. Both parts share identical connector type, contact configuration, pitch, row spacing, mounting type, shrouding, and termination method. The primary difference is product status (active vs. obsolete) and RoHS compliance. Electrical and mechanical compatibility is complete.

Q: What are the voltage and current limitations when substituting with alternative manufacturers?

A: The original part operates at 2A and 250V. Substitute parts from TE Connectivity (1470109-8) are rated 3A at 100VDC, JST (B8B-PHDSS(LF)(SN)) are rated 3A at 250V, and Sullins (SWR204-NRTN-D04-ST-GA) are rated 3A per contact at 50V. Application requirements must not exceed the voltage rating of the selected substitute.

Q: Are there packaging differences between substitute parts?

A: Yes. DF11-8DP-2DSA(20) and DF11-8DP-2DSA(24) are packaged in tube and tube formats respectively. TE Connectivity 1470109-8, JST B8B-PHDSS(LF)(SN), and Sullins SWR204-NRTN-D04-ST-GA are supplied in bulk packaging. Packaging does not affect electrical or mechanical compatibility.

Q: Do all substitute parts meet RoHS requirements?

A: The original DF11-8DP-2DSA(20) is RoHS non-compliant. All identified substitutes (DF11-8DP-2DSA(24), 1470109-8, B8B-PHDSS(LF)(SN), and SWR204-NRTN-D04-ST-GA) are ROHS3 compliant, making them suitable for applications requiring RoHS compliance.

Q: What is the operating temperature range for each substitute?

A: DF11-8DP-2DSA(20) and DF11-8DP-2DSA(24) operate from -30°C to 85°C. All other substitutes (1470109-8, B8B-PHDSS(LF)(SN), and SWR204-NRTN-D04-ST-GA) operate from -25°C to 85°C. The narrower range of substitute parts does not affect most standard applications.

Q: Are contact material differences significant for substitution?

A: The original part uses brass contacts. TE Connectivity and Sullins substitutes also use brass, while JST B8B-PHDSS(LF)(SN) uses copper alloy. Both materials provide equivalent electrical conductivity and contact reliability for this connector class. Material selection does not preclude functional substitution.
